What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R  1926.1052(b)(1): Except during stairway construction, foot traffic was not  prohibited on stairways with pan stairs where the treads and/or landings are to be filled in with concrete or other material at a later date, unless the stairs are temporarily fitted with wood or other solid material at least to the top edge of each pan:   33 Jackson Rd., Devens, MA: On or about July 12, Stairways with pan stairs where the treads were  to be filled at a later date with concrete or other material were  filled with rigid foam insulation panels, a non solid material and not filled with wood or other solid material to the top edge of each pan.

29 CFR  1926.1053(b)(5)(i):Non-self-supporting ladders were used at an angle such that the horizontal distance from the top support to the foot of the ladder was greater than approximately one-quarter of the working length of the ladder (the distance along the ladder between the foot and the top support):  33 Jackson Rd., Devens, MA: On or about July 12, 2022, an employee was observed using a fiberglass extension ladder to reach the roof  that was  set at a nearly 4 to 3 angle instead of the required 4 to 1 angle.
